NZX dual-class share proposals: implications for directors
WEBINAR: NZX is consulting on proposals to introduce dual-class share structures for eligible new listings on the NZX Main Board. The proposals are intended to support more companies to access public capital while allowing founders to retain greater voting control after listing, alongside governance safeguards designed to maintain investor confidence.

POSTPONED: EastPack Site Tour 2026
EastPack co-op employs over 3,500 staff during the main packing season and has capacity to pack over 25% of New Zealand’s total kiwifruit volume. It's invested significant capital in new equipment to improve productivity, and made major inroads into sustainability improvements.
